Optimal H\"older Continuity and Dimension Properties for SLE with Minkowski Content Parametrization

Abstract
We make use of the fact that a two-sided whole-plane Schramm-Loewner evolution (SLE) curve for from to through may be parametrized by its -dimensional Minkowski content, where , and become a self-similar process of index with stationary increments. We prove that such is locally -H\"older continuous for any . In the case , we show that is not locally -H\"older continuous. We also prove that, for any deterministic closed set , the Hausdorff dimension of almost surely equals times the Hausdorff dimension of .
